As for apps. Get SwiftKey it's the best keyboard you can get. Also get light flow, it let's you customise the led for notifications. As I already mentioned download chrome as it's the best browser.

Also go into s voice app and hit settings and un check the launch s voice box. It removes lag when hitting the home button.

Oh and of course Kies Air is fantastic. Basically you install the app on your phone and when you turn it on you are given a url to put into a browser on the same wifi network. You can now access your phone and use it via the browser, be it copy files, send text messages, etc.. you can do it all from you pc while your phone charges in your bedroom.

Tis awesome and shows off how great Android really is.
